H A Dboard.cf0017175e33d7c21269deebc5e2ca2827b1e5975 Fri Sep 05 11:23:30 UTC 2014 Ajay Kumar <ajaykumar.rs@samsung.com> exynos_fb: Remove usage of static defines

Previously, we used to statically assign values for vl_col, vl_row and
vl_bpix using #defines like LCD_XRES, LCD_YRES and LCD_COLOR16.

Introducing the function exynos_lcd_early_init() would take care of this
assignment on the fly by parsing FIMD DT properties, thereby allowing us
to remove LCD_XRES and LCD_YRES from the main config file.
